Output ec8cd412debe59c0b317aee7efa6a78398b893661c452c26798741ec5a5a31bf:0

value
25235828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9a9149549a0ee213be8ea21fe0a0cfdf99f3df0 OP_EQUAL
address
3MXu75nVkBRsZR2jNAf4U7iFdUvkpSCi79
transaction
ec8cd412debe59c0b317aee7efa6a78398b893661c452c26798741ec5a5a31bf
spent
true